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to check for underlying issues.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Call a pro for large-scale water extraction and drying.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Don’t try to fix wet drywall yourself, call a pro for safe and effective repair. |
| Hidden water leak behind walls | No | Yes | Call a pro for advanced moisture detection and repair. |
| Leaky pipe under sink |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to check for underlying issues. |
| Basement flood with sewage backup | No | Yes | Call a pro for safe and effective sewage cleanup and disposal. |

Water Leak Detection Cost In The 98011 Area
The cost of water leak detection and repair can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 98011 area. Our team provides free estimates and will work with you to find out the best course of action for your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of leak |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of drying process |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of moisture detection |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of sewage backup |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of drying process |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of moisture detection |

Common Questions About Water Leak Detection In The 98011 Area
What are the signs of a hidden water leak?
A hidden water leak can be difficult to detect, but common signs include water stains on walls or ceilings, warped or buckled flooring, and musty odors. If you suspect a hidden water leak, contact us immediately for emergency water leak detection and repair services.

Do I need to evacuate my property during water leak detection and repair?
In some cases, it may be necessary to evacuate your property during water leak detection and repair, especially if the leak is severe or if there is a risk of electrical shock.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and ensure your safety throughout the process.
